While Naples and its surrounding areas offer a wealth of attractions and experiences, there are a few pain points to consider before planning your trip. One of the biggest challenges is navigating the city’s busy streets and finding parking. Additionally, some of the historical sites and landmarks can be crowded and require advanced booking to avoid long lines.
If you’re planning a trip to Naples and its surrounding areas, there are several must-visit attractions. Start by exploring the historic center of Naples,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that boasts a variety of stunning architecture and landmarks, including the Royal Palace of Naples and the Castel dell’Ovo. Next, take a scenic drive along the Amalfi Coast, stopping in charming towns like Positano and Ravello. Finally, don’t miss the chance to hike to the top of Mount Vesuvius, one of the world’s most famous volcanoes.

Exploring the Beauty of Amalfi Coast
The Amalfi Coast is undoubtedly one of the most stunning parts of Naples and its surrounding areas. The drive along the coast is breathtaking, with picturesque towns and villages dotted along the way. You can also take a boat tour to see the coastline from a different perspective. Don’t miss the opportunity to explore the charming town of Positano, with its colorful buildings tumbling down the hillsides towards the sea.
Visiting the Ruins of Pompeii
The ancient city of Pompeii is a must-see attraction for history buffs and anyone interested in the rich cultural heritage of the area. The city was buried under volcanic ash in 79 AD after the eruption of Mount Vesuvius and was only rediscovered in the 18th century. Today, visitors can explore the well-preserved ruins and get a glimpse of what life was like in ancient Pompeii.
Discovering the Charm of Naples’ Historic Center
Naples’ historic center is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and is home to some of the city’s most iconic landmarks. Take a stroll through the narrow streets and alleys, stopping at landmarks like the Royal Palace of Naples and the Castel dell’Ovo. Don’t miss the chance to sample some of the city’s famous pizza, which is said to have originated in Naples.
Ascending Mount Vesuvius
Hiking to the summit of Mount Vesuvius is an unforgettable experience and offers stunning views of the surrounding landscape. The hike is challenging but manageable, and you can also take a guided tour to learn about the history and geology of the area. Be sure to wear sturdy shoes and bring plenty of water and sunscreen.

Q: How do I get around Naples and its surrounding areas?
A: While driving can be challenging in Naples, there are several public transportation options, including buses and trains. Taxis are also available but can be expensive.
Q: What is the best time of year to visit Naples and its surrounding areas?
A: The best time to visit is between April and June or September and October when the weather is mild and crowds are thinner.
Q: What are some of the best restaurants in Naples?
A: Naples is famous for its pizza, and there are several excellent pizzerias in the city, including L’Antica Pizzeria da Michele and Sorbillo. For seafood, try Mimi alla Ferrovia or La Cantina di Triunfo.
